Ingredients

For this mouthwatering Grilled Steak with Juicy Shrimp & Creamy Lobster Sauce recipe, you will need the following ingredients:

– High-quality steak cuts (such as ribeye or filet mignon) – Fresh shrimp, peeled and deveined – Lobster tails – Butter – Olive oil – Garlic, minced – Heavy cream – White wine – Lemon juice – Fresh herbs (such as parsley and thyme) – Salt and pepper to taste

Steps

1. Begin by preparing the steak cuts, ensuring they are at room temperature before grilling to achieve the perfect cook.

2. Season the steak with salt and pepper, then grill to your desired level of doneness. Set aside to rest while you prepare the shrimp and lobster.

3. In a separate pan, melt butter and olive oil over medium heat. Add minced garlic and sauté until fragrant.

4. Add the shrimp and lobster tails to the pan, cooking until they turn pink and opaque. Remove from the pan and set aside.

Tips

Here are some tips to elevate your Grilled Steak with Juicy Shrimp & Creamy Lobster Sauce:

– Ensure your grill is preheated to the correct temperature to achieve beautiful grill marks on the steak. – Use fresh, high-quality ingredients for the best flavor results. – Do not overcook the seafood to prevent it from becoming tough and rubbery.

FAQs

Q: Can I use frozen seafood for this recipe?

A: While fresh seafood is recommended for the best flavor and texture, you can use high-quality frozen seafood as a convenient alternative.

Q: How can I store leftovers of this dish?

A: Store any leftover steak, shrimp, and lobster sauce in airtight containers in the refrigerator for up to 2 days. Reheat gently on the stove or in the microwave before serving.
